Access is understood in terms of permission and consent.
Consent is at the human level, it is related to a purpose. Permission is related to the mechanics of access, credentials.
An agent-centric system puts consent before, the purpose is supposed to drive access and even revoke permissions.
Permissionless systems are purely consent based.
